Touching Them All

An amazing story about sportsmanship in a college women’s softball game last Saturday in Ellensburg, Washington.  A great example of the power of character and the impact one person can have on another.  ESPN
Western Oregon’s Sara Tucholsky is carried around the bases by Central Washington’s Liz Wallace, left, and Mallory Holtman after injuring her knee following her home run during their softball game Saturday April 26, 2008, in Ellensburg, Wash. With two runners on base and a strike against her, Tucholsky uncorked her best swing and did something she had never done, in high school or college. Her first home run cleared the center-field fence
